Active COVID-19 cases at 14 on Walpole Island, school re-opening on Thursday

Bkejwanong Kinomaagewgamig, the elementary school on Walpole Island, will re-open on Thursday, October 7.

“Students can submit completed work packages when they return to the classroom,” school officials said on social media on Tuesday.

The school closed back on September 24, due to a spike in COVID-19 cases.

Walpole Island officials said on Tuesday, October 5, 2021 there are currently 14 active COVID-19 cases on the First Nation reserve.

Since the pandemic began, 216 positive cases have been confirmed on Walpole, 1,587 tests have been conducted and four people have died.

There are also 13 pending cases, Walpole Island officials say.
